About the Role

Invercargill’s water networks require active maintenance, and as a Water Serviceperson you will be out in the field maintaining assets, responding to faults and restoring services for homes, businesses and emergency services. The role is practical, boots‑on‑the‑ground work performed in all conditions and often under time pressure. You will own each job from start to finish, handling fault response, customer interaction, reinstatement and reporting while adhering to contract requirements and Downer procedures. You will also join a standby and call‑out roster, supporting incidents and civil emergencies when needed. If you take pride in solid workmanship, look out for your crew and view safety as non‑negotiable, your skills will truly matter in this position. • Maintain and repair water network assets in the field. • Respond to faults and restore services for residential, commercial and emergency clients. • Diagnose faults, interact with customers, perform reinstatement, and complete field reporting. • Participate in standby and call‑out roster to support incidents and civil emergencies. • Follow contract requirements, Downer procedures, and strict safety standards.

What You Bring

We are looking for candidates with experience on water reticulation networks, strong fault‑finding abilities and a calm approach under pressure. Confidence in dealing with the public, competence in field reporting via mobile devices, and an uncompromising focus on safety are essential. A full Class 1 driver’s licence is required, with Class 2, RTW, confined‑space or traffic‑management credentials considered a bonus. • Experience working on water reticulation networks. • Strong fault‑finding skills and ability to stay calm under pressure. • Confident communication with the public during service disruptions. • Proficiency with mobile devices for field reporting. • Full Class 1 driver’s licence (Class 2, RTW, confined‑space or traffic‑management certifications desirable). • Reliable, practical attitude; able to start early, work in cold conditions and handle dirty tasks.
